在共享主机环境下,通常会为每个用户提供一个单独的FTP帐户、数据库用户以及文件存储空间。在某些情况下,您可能需要对这些资源进行更细粒度的控制,例如限制其他用户访问您的网站或应用程序的数据和配置文件。
在这种情况下,就需要设置独立的管理权限了。接下来我们将介绍如何在共享主机环境中设置独立的管理权限。
1. 创建子目录并分配权限
如果您的网站托管在一个共享服务器上,并且希望确保只有特定的人能够修改某些页面,则可以考虑将这些页面放在一个单独的子目录中。然后,通过使用文件传输协议(FTP)客户端软件连接到服务器后,右键单击该文件夹并选择“属性”,接着就可以根据需要调整文件夹及其中内容的所有者与组信息,从而实现权限分配。
2. 使用.htaccess文件设置访问控制
.htaccess 文件是 Apache Web 服务器用于配置目录级别的选项的特殊配置文件。它允许我们定义规则来限制哪些 IP 地址可以访问特定 URL 或整个站点,也可以用来设置密码保护某些部分不被未授权人员查看。
要创建 .htaccess 文件,请先确保您的主机支持此功能。然后打开文本编辑器并输入如下代码:
Order deny,allow
Deny from all
Allow from 192.168.0.1
这行命令表示拒绝所有请求但允许来自指定 IP 地址(此处以192.168.0.1为例)的连接。如果您想让多个地址有权限进入,则可以在每行添加一个新的 “Allow from” 指令。
3. 利用面板提供的多用户管理功能
大多数现代Web托管服务提供商都会提供某种形式的用户管理系统,使管理员能够轻松地向团队成员授予不同级别的访问权限。例如,在 cPanel 中,您可以转到“首选项”菜单下的“子账户”选项卡,点击“添加子账户”按钮,按照提示完成新用户的创建过程。之后便可以选择要给予他们的具体权利范围。
4. 安装安全插件增强防护
对于基于 CMS (如 WordPress) 构建的站点来说,安装额外的安全插件也是一种有效的方法。这类工具可以帮助检测潜在威胁、阻止恶意登录尝试、加密敏感数据等。它们还经常带有自定义角色和能力的功能,使得进一步细化每个注册用户所能执行的操作变得更加容易。
以上就是在共享主机环境中设置独立管理权限的一些常见方法。无论采用哪种方式,都必须始终牢记一点:安全永远是第一位的!因此请务必定期检查现有的安全措施是否足够强大,并及时更新任何过时或存在漏洞的部分。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/185798.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。